Please help <br> The diagram shows a 5ft student standing near a tree
Novosadov [1.4K]

Answer:

25 ft

Step-by-step explanation:

The diagram shows two triangles that are similar.  Similar triangles have equal angles and sides that are proportional to each other.  Since the base of each triangle is given, we can find the proportion of the sides:

\frac{smaller}{larger}=\frac{8}{40}=\frac{1}{5}

Given the ratio of the smaller to larger triangle, we can set up a proportion to find the missing height of the larger triangle:

\frac{1}{5}=\frac{5}{x}, where 'x' represent the height of the tree

cross-multiply:  x = (5)(5) or 25 ft

The blood platelet counts of a group of women have a​ bell-shaped distribution with a mean of 247.9 and a standard deviation of
labwork [276]

Answer:

A) Approximate percentage of women with platelet counts within 2 standard deviations of the​ mean, or between 118.5 and 377.3 = 95%

B) approximate percentage of women with platelet counts between 53.8 and 442.0 = 99.7%

Step-by-step explanation:

We are given;

mean;μ = 247.9

standard deviation;σ = 64.7

A) We want to find the approximate percentage of women with platelet counts within 2 standard deviations of the​ mean, or between 118.5 and 377.3.

Now, from the image attached, we can see that from the empirical curve, the probability of 1 standard deviation from the mean is (34% + 34%) = 68 %.

While probability of 2 standard deviations from the mean is (13.5% + 34% + 34% + 13.5%) = 95%

Thus, approximate percentage of women with platelet counts within 2 standard deviations of the​ mean, or between 118.5 and 377.3 = 95%

B) Now, we want to find the approximate percentage of women with platelet counts between 53.8 and 442.0.

53.8 and 442.0 represents 3 standard deviations from the mean.

Let's confirm that.

Since mean;μ = 247.9

standard deviation;σ = 64.7 ;

μ = 247.9

σ = 64.7

μ + 3σ = 247.9 + 3(64.7) = 442

Also;

μ - 3σ = 247.9 - 3(64.7) = 53.8

Again from the empirical curve attached, we cans that at 3 standard deviations from the mean, we have a percentage probability of;

(2.35% + 13.5% + 34% + 34% + 13.5% + 2.35%) = 99.7%
